Job Description

The Regional Business Director, Liver, Northeast is responsible for leading the Rare Disease commercial field force within the defined Northeast territory. This includes MA, CT, RI, VT, NH, ME, NYC.

Responsibilities include the development and implementation of a thorough regional business plan to successfully accelerate the performance of Bylvay in the Progressive Familial Intrahepatic Cholestasis (PFIC) and Alagille Syndrome (ALGS) indications, and IQVIRO in Primary Biliary Cholangitis (PBC). The RBD will develop the business plan for the Northeast and implement national sales strategies and programs.

What - Main Responsibilities
  • Lead the Northeast Rare Disease sales force activities including recruiting, hiring, training, development, performance evaluation of your direct reports (team of 8 Clinical Science Specialists).
  • Responsible along with the team of CSSs, for assessing current business practices in each target account across the region, and assess best ways to compliantly build key partnering relationships.
  • Leverage internal cross-functional resources, such as Medical, Patient Support Services, and Value & Access and partner with key thought leaders to develop a full understanding of referral pathways in each territory.
  • Build short and long-term business plans to serve HCPs and patients and, consequently, drive performance growth.
  • Secure right prioritization and alignment of field activities with strategic initiatives.
  • Accountable for deployment of target approved promotional peer-to-peer programs.
  • Coach Clinical Science Specialists (CSSs) in line with Ipsen customer engagement model to drive sustained improvement in core sales competencies, including disease state and product knowledge as well as reimbursement/fulfillment skills, while ensuring compliance with Ipsen standards and policies.
  • Partner with members of the Value & Access team to develop appropriate business strategies that drive access to the brand and support brand objectives.
  • Partner with Patient Support Services to ensure compliant education of appropriate offices’ staff on access and reimbursement, and seamless appropriate patient access to product following Rx.
  • Partner with Business Operations to leverage data analytics to inform the field team and drive performance.
  • Build and sustain relationships with target Thought Leaders.
  • Systematically communicate market intelligence to brand teams and senior management.
  • Ensure frequent communication with direct manager and peers about plan progress for each territory, along with specific support needed.
  • Develop and deliver presentations to the organization overall and senior management, ensuring clear understanding across the organization of opportunities & challenges.
How - Knowledge & Experience
  • BA/BS degree is required, an advanced degree would be a plus.
  • 10 years of sales/marketing experience within biopharma, with at least 5 years of sales leadership/management of rare disease products.
  • Extensive knowledge of US payer landscape along with factors that drive access and product pull-through.
  • Demonstrated leadership skills and a track record of delivering exceptional business results.
  • Multiple product launch experiences; in Rare Disease is a plus.
  • Familiar with trade relations, reimbursement environment, government programs, and managed care.
  • Superior presentation skills, outstanding communication skills including written and verbal.
  • Ability to tactfully handle various situations and make decisions in a professional and unbiased manner.
  • Significant experience with payer or integrated health systems and key account management.
  • Located within the defined Northeast region.
Compensation

The annual base salary range for this position is $165,750 - $245,000. This job is eligible to participate in our short-term incentives program.

  • We are proud to offer a comprehensive employee benefits package, including 401(k) with company contributions, group medical, dental and vision coverage, life and disability insurance, short- and long-term disability insurance, as well as flexible spending accounts.
  • Ipsen also provides parental leave, paid time off, a discretionary winter shutdown, well-being allowance, commuter benefits, and much more.

The pay range displayed above is the range of base pay compensation within which Ipsen expects to pay for this role at the time of this posting. Individual compensation within this range depends on a variety of factors, including, but not limited to, prior education and experience, job-related knowledge and demonstrated skills.
